Silky Rails is a train-building survival game where players assemble and upgrade carts to automatically battle waves of enemies along the Silk Road.

Silky Rails is a strategy game centred on building and managing a train that travels along the Silk Road, facing waves of enemies at each station. Players acquire unique carts and position them strategically to form combat setups, while the train fights automatically without direct player control during battles.

Core mechanics include merging three carts of the same type and level to upgrade them into higher-tier variations, as well as managing resources to unlock relics and traits that affect combat performance. Players also make decisions at events along the route, which can lead to rewards, new opportunities, or added danger.

The game combines economic management, cart placement, and progression systems, requiring players to adapt their train’s layout and resources as they advance through increasingly difficult stages of the journey.
